Eric Johnson Still[1] (born June 28, 1967) is a former American football offensive guard who played college football at the University of Tennessee and attended Germantown High School in Germantown, Tennessee.[1] He was drafted by the Houston Oilers in the fourth round of the 1990 NFL Draft.[2] He was a consensus All-American in 1989.[3][4] He played two season with the Frankfurt Galaxy of the World League of American Football.[5]
